Spicers finds new way to sell paper with ‘warehouse on wheels’

The Spicers Xpress van has started making daily runs to parts of Sydney to see if small and medium-sized printers need to stock up on digital paper and consumables.

Emerging business manager Rohan Dean said it wouldn't be long before a second Sydney van was added and the concept introduced to other cities.

"This market has a growing presence of digital equipment and we thought that we could better deliver our digital papers in the speed of on-demand via a mobile warehouse," he told ProPrint.

"We initially underestimated the ability of the van to upsell and not only just sell items out of the van’s stock. So it creates orders as well that can be delivered next day or on our bulk trucks if it’s pallet lots."

A text messaging alert system will soon be added, so customers can prepare their orders before the van arrives.

Spicers' New Zealand business was the first to introduce a sales van.
